What major trade cities where located in Africa and Asia
Tju [1.3M]

Explanation:

As trade intensified between Africa and Asia, prosperous city-states flourished along the eastern coast of Africa. These included Kilwa, Sofala, Mombasa, Malindi, and others. The city-states traded with inland kingdoms like Great Zimbabwe to obtain gold, ivory, and iron.

Who were the minutemen
Artyom0805 [142]

The minutemen were groups of eager young colonial militiamen who stood ready to fight at a minute’s notice. If the minutemen had failed in the earliest battles of the American Revolution, history might have taken a different course.
